47dea673e9SRodney W. Grimes /*
48dea673e9SRodney W. Grimes  * Inetd - Internet super-server
49dea673e9SRodney W. Grimes  *
50dea673e9SRodney W. Grimes  * This program invokes all internet services as needed.  Connection-oriented
51dea673e9SRodney W. Grimes  * services are invoked each time a connection is made, by creating a process.
52dea673e9SRodney W. Grimes  * This process is passed the connection as file descriptor 0 and is expected
53dea673e9SRodney W. Grimes  * to do a getpeername to find out the source host and port.
54dea673e9SRodney W. Grimes  *
55dea673e9SRodney W. Grimes  * Datagram oriented services are invoked when a datagram
56dea673e9SRodney W. Grimes  * arrives; a process is created and passed a pending message
57dea673e9SRodney W. Grimes  * on file descriptor 0.  Datagram servers may either connect
58dea673e9SRodney W. Grimes  * to their peer, freeing up the original socket for inetd
59dea673e9SRodney W. Grimes  * to receive further messages on, or ``take over the socket'',
60dea673e9SRodney W. Grimes  * processing all arriving datagrams and, eventually, timing
61dea673e9SRodney W. Grimes  * out.	 The first type of server is said to be ``multi-threaded'';
62dea673e9SRodney W. Grimes  * the second type of server ``single-threaded''.
63dea673e9SRodney W. Grimes  *
64dea673e9SRodney W. Grimes  * Inetd uses a configuration file which is read at startup
65dea673e9SRodney W. Grimes  * and, possibly, at some later time in response to a hangup signal.
66dea673e9SRodney W. Grimes  * The configuration file is ``free format'' with fields given in the
67caf60155SDavid Malone  * order shown below.  Continuation lines for an entry must begin with
68dea673e9SRodney W. Grimes  * a space or tab.  All fields must be present in each entry.
69dea673e9SRodney W. Grimes  *
701c8d1174SDavid Malone  *	service name			must be in /etc/services
711c8d1174SDavid Malone  *					or name a tcpmux service
721c8d1174SDavid Malone  *					or specify a unix domain socket
73dea673e9SRodney W. Grimes  *	socket type			stream/dgram/raw/rdm/seqpacket
74603eaf79SAlexander V. Chernikov  *	protocol			tcp[4][6], udp[4][6], unix
75dea673e9SRodney W. Grimes  *	wait/nowait			single-threaded/multi-threaded
76882284ccSXin LI  *	user[:group][/login-class]	user/group/login-class to run daemon as
77dea673e9SRodney W. Grimes  *	server program			full path name
78dea673e9SRodney W. Grimes  *	server program arguments	maximum of MAXARGS (20)
79dea673e9SRodney W. Grimes  *
80dea673e9SRodney W. Grimes  * TCP services without official port numbers are handled with the
81dea673e9SRodney W. Grimes  * RFC1078-based tcpmux internal service. Tcpmux listens on port 1 for
82dea673e9SRodney W. Grimes  * requests. When a connection is made from a foreign host, the service
83dea673e9SRodney W. Grimes  * requested is passed to tcpmux, which looks it up in the servtab list
84dea673e9SRodney W. Grimes  * and returns the proper entry for the service. Tcpmux returns a
85dea673e9SRodney W. Grimes  * negative reply if the service doesn't exist, otherwise the invoked
86dea673e9SRodney W. Grimes  * server is expected to return the positive reply if the service type in
87dea673e9SRodney W. Grimes  * inetd.conf file has the prefix "tcpmux/". If the service type has the
88dea673e9SRodney W. Grimes  * prefix "tcpmux/+", tcpmux will return the positive reply for the
89dea673e9SRodney W. Grimes  * process; this is for compatibility with older server code, and also
90dea673e9SRodney W. Grimes  * allows you to invoke programs that use stdin/stdout without putting any
91dea673e9SRodney W. Grimes  * special server code in them. Services that use tcpmux are "nowait"
92dea673e9SRodney W. Grimes  * because they do not have a well-known port and hence cannot listen
93dea673e9SRodney W. Grimes  * for new requests.
94dea673e9SRodney W. Grimes  *
9555b91f3aSGeoff Rehmet  * For RPC services
9655b91f3aSGeoff Rehmet  *	service name/version		must be in /etc/rpc
9755b91f3aSGeoff Rehmet  *	socket type			stream/dgram/raw/rdm/seqpacket
98d14ca883SAlfred Perlstein  *	protocol			rpc/tcp[4][6], rpc/udp[4][6]
9955b91f3aSGeoff Rehmet  *	wait/nowait			single-threaded/multi-threaded
100882284ccSXin LI  *	user[:group][/login-class]	user/group/login-class to run daemon as
10155b91f3aSGeoff Rehmet  *	server program			full path name
10255b91f3aSGeoff Rehmet  *	server program arguments	maximum of MAXARGS
10355b91f3aSGeoff Rehmet  *
104dea673e9SRodney W. Grimes  * Comment lines are indicated by a `#' in column 1.
1050cac72f4SYoshinobu Inoue  *
1060cac72f4SYoshinobu Inoue  * #ifdef IPSEC
1070cac72f4SYoshinobu Inoue  * Comment lines that start with "#@" denote IPsec policy string, as described
1080cac72f4SYoshinobu Inoue  * in ipsec_set_policy(3).  This will affect all the following items in
1090cac72f4SYoshinobu Inoue  * inetd.conf(8).  To reset the policy, just use "#@" line.  By default,
1100cac72f4SYoshinobu Inoue  * there's no IPsec policy.
1110cac72f4SYoshinobu Inoue  * #endif
112dea673e9SRodney W. Grimes  */
